Medicare Advantage Plans in York County, ME:
Your Complete 2026 Guide
For 2026, residents of York County, ME can choose from 25 Medicare Advantage plan options. Of these, 17 cost nothing beyond the Part B premium. Enrollment in the County stands at approximately 23,123, with 54% of plans achieving 4 stars or better. This page and its statistics exclude Special Needs Plans (SNPs). Medicare Advantage PPO Plans
Preferred Provider Organization (PPO) plans allow members to choose care from both in-network and out-of-network providers. While using out-of-network doctors or hospitals usually means higher costs, PPOs may appeal to people who want more flexibility in how they access their healthcare.

Medicare Advantage HMO Plans
Health Maintenance Organization (HMO) plans generally require members to use doctors, hospitals, and other providers within the plan’s network, except in emergencies. Because of this structure, HMOs often come with lower premiums and out-of-pocket costs compared with other plan types.

Medicare Advantage HMO-POS Plans
HMO-POS plans are structured like HMOs, requiring in-network care for the lowest costs, but they also permit some use of out-of-network doctors and hospitals. Those services are generally more expensive, but the added access can be valuable for people who don’t want to be fully limited to a single network.

Medicare Advantage comes with strict enrollment windows. By knowing when and how to sign up, you’ll avoid missed deadlines and keep your healthcare coverage aligned with your needs.
Key Medicare Enrollment Periods
- Initial Enrollment Period (IEP): This seven-month window starts three months before the month you turn 65 and ends three months after. It’s the first time you can sign up for Medicare and, if you choose, a Medicare Advantage plan. Learn more
- Medicare Advantage Open Enrollment Period (MA OEP): Each year from January 1 through March 31, you may change to another Medicare Advantage plan or drop your plan and return to Original Medicare. Learn more
- Annual Enrollment Period (AEP): This yearly window, running October 15 to December 7, gives you the opportunity to join, switch, or drop Medicare Advantage and Part D plans. Learn more
- Special Enrollment Periods (SEPs): Certain qualifying events, such as a change in residence or loss of existing coverage, may allow you to enroll in or change Medicare Advantage plans outside of the usual enrollment windows. Learn more
